    Performance & Processor

    A tablet good for studying must be powerful enough to handle multitasking. Whether you're switching between note apps, video conferencing, and cloud storage, the processor should ensure seamless transitions without lag. The HONOR MagicPad2 features a Snapdragon 8s Gen 3 for powerful multi-tasking, while the HONOR Pad V9 runs on the MediaTek Dimensity 8350 Elite with ultra-low power consumption and improved AI capabilities. For budget-conscious students, the HONOR Pad X8a is among the most affordable tablets for students that utilize the Snapdragon 680 for efficient everyday use.

    Display Quality & Eye Comfort

    Students in college often spend long hours reading or working on screens. A tablet for university with an eye-comfort certified display, like those with TÜV Rheinland Low Blue Light certification, helps reduce eye strain. HONOR tablets for uni students like the MagicPad2 and Pad X9a offer TÜV-certified screens, while the Pad V9 includes advanced eye protection technologies like Dynamic Dimming and Circadian Night Display.

    Battery Life

    A good tablet for university students should last the entire school day on a single charge, preferably 8 to 12 hours. The HONOR Pad V9 features a 10100mAh battery for day-and-night usage, while the Pad X8a offers up to 14 hours of local video playback and 85 hours of music on a full charge. MagicPad2 also provides all-day battery with its 10050mAh cell and 66W HONOR SuperCharge fast charging.

    What is better for university, a tablet or a laptop?

    FAQ 2
    It depends on your needs. Tablets are lightweight, great for note-taking, reading, and portability. Laptops offer more power for software-heavy tasks like coding or design. For most students, a tablet with keyboard and stylus support can replace a laptop for everyday studying, especially when mobility and versatility are priorities.

    Do I need a tablet for computer science?

    FAQ 7
    A tablet isn't strictly necessary for computer science, but can be a helpful companion. A Tablet for computer science students is great for reading documentation, taking notes, and attending online lectures. However, for programming, compiling code, or running development environments, a laptop or desktop with a full OS and keyboard is more suitable.

    Should You Buy a Wi-Fi Only or Cellular Tablet?

    FAQ 11
    A Wi-Fi-only tablet is a smart choice if you study mostly at home, school, or places with stable internet. A cellular tablet offers more flexibility for frequent travellers or those needing internet on the go.
